Understanding the Mountain Icons Set
The Mountain Icons Set is a collection of vector-based icons centered around the theme of mountains. It includes three distinct icon styles: filled line, line, and solid. These icons are provided in SVG and EPS formats, making them compatible with popular design software such as Adobe Illustrator, Inkscape, Affinity Designer, and Gravit Designer. The icons are designed with an isolated background, allowing for easy integration into a wide range of digital projects including websites, mobile apps, and infographics.
Each icon in the Mountain Icons Set is crafted with a clean, modern aesthetic. The line and solid styles offer flexibility in visual presentation, and the editable stroke feature allows for customization to match specific design needs. This makes the set particularly useful for designers who need scalable, high-quality graphics that can be easily adjusted without loss of clarity.

Considerations and Tradeoffs
While the Mountain Icons Set offers many advantages, it's important to consider whether it aligns with the broader design goals of your project. For instance, if your project requires a more abstract or symbolic visual language, a nature-themed icon set may not be the best fit. Similarly, if you need icons covering a wide range of unrelated topics, this set—being focused on mountain imagery—may not provide sufficient variety.
Additionally, while the set includes three styles, some design systems may require additional variations such as color icons, glyph icons, or animated versions, which are not included here. Users should also be comfortable working with vector files, as the benefits of scalability and editability are only fully realized with the appropriate software and skillset.
